Transcriptional and epigenetic mechanisms of promiscuous gene expression by thymic epithelial cells
The thymus is the primary lymphoid organ responsible for the generation and selection of a T-cell repertoire that is able to respond to foreign antigens whilst remaining tolerant to self.
